USHL is considered by most to be the top junior development league in the United States.* In recent years, the league has been producing what seems to be an ever growing crop of NHL draftees, some of whom have flown somewhat under the radar even after being drafted.
One such player is San Jose Sharks prospect,
Sean Kuraly, a burgeoning power forward who spent the past two seasons plus a small portion of a third playing for the USHL's Indiana Ice. The Dublin, Ohio native capped off his USHL career in 2011-12 with a strong season, one in which he netted 32 goals and added 38 assists for 70 points in 54 games.…
